Two Stan dramas this week and an AppleTV+ remake.
Presumed Innocent (AppleTV+, 8 episodes) is a remake of the 1990 court-room drama movie of the same name starring Harrison Ford. In this TV version, Jake Gyllenhaal takes the lead role as he investigates the murder of a colleague.
Exposure (Stan, 6 episodes) tells the story of Jacs Gould (played by Alice Englert), a photographer, who is coming to terms with the death by suicide of her closest friend. While searching for answers her own buried trauma percolates to the surface.
Lost Boys and Fairies (Stan, 3 episodes) is about Welsh gay couple Gabriel and his partner Andy and the challenges they face trying to adopt a child.
